![]() Both are included in the standard library, so no additional installation is necessary. Finally, if you want to print to the entire file, you simply use a for loop after creating the data-object. In the third step, we will use the writerows () or writerow () function to write the. As you can see, we can easily access different parts of the file by using our readcsv() function and creating a nested-list object. ![]() Next we will create a writer () object that will help us write data into the CSV file. They are: We need to open () the file in the write (‘w’) mode. There are mainly four steps to creating a CSV file in python. The sample code in this article uses the csv and pprint modules. Creating a CSV File in Python: The Basics. This is like creating a new blank spreadsheet. For a comprehensive understanding of these, refer to the official documentation above.Īs will be discussed later in this article, it is recommended to use libraries like NumPy or pandas for operations such as calculating averages or totals from data read from CSV files. First, we need to open a new file using Python’s built-in open function. This article doesn't cover all possible arguments for the functions in the csv module. Compare the differences between these classes and other options for writing CSV files. See the syntax, parameters and examples of csv.writer and csv.DictWriter classes. fields csvreader.next () csvreader is an iterable object. If you want to read the CSV file later into Excel, you could specify the Excel dialect explicitly just to make your intention clear. You should simply construct csv.writer with the default delimiter and dialect. We save the csv.reader object as csvreader. CSV files use commas or semicolons (in Excel) as cell delimiters, so if you use delimiter' ', you are not really producing a CSV file. The file object is converted to csv.reader object. Read CSV files as dictionaries: csv.DictReader() Learn how to use the csv module in Python to write tabular data in CSV format. with open (filename, 'r') as csvfile: csvreader csv.reader (csvfile) Here, we first open the CSV file in READ mode.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|